Chumbawamba had been kicking around the British anarchist and indie scene for years, having released seven studio albums, before "Tubthumper" unexpectedly brought the band to the top of the charts around the world through the album's title track "Tubthumping". The band now being mostly remembered as a one hit wonder, the song is a giddily celebratory blend of big dance beats, pop hooks, and football chants. Chumbawamba was an English musical group formed in 1982 in the Leeds squatting community. They have, over a career spanning nearly three decades, played punk rock, pop-influenced music, world music, and folk music. Their vocal anarchist politics exhibit an irreverent attitude toward authority; the band have been forthright in their syndicalist, pacifist, communist, mutlicultural, and feminist social stances.
